Transcript excerpt

Everyone. I work at the Goodwill best, and every week, we have to throw away Isabel Marant stuff because we just get so much. So the first few times people started finding Isabel Marant, everyone was super excited. Obviously, the resellers were stoked. They were selling on Depop or whatever and making a lot of money. But we started to get in so much Isabel Marant to the point where all of the employees have their own crazy Isabel Marant closets, and people have tried to post as much as they could on Depop and things like that. It's just it's just too much. So we've had to start actively throwing away the pieces. I was talking to some of my other friends that work at the bins in other locations, and they said it's the same situation. For some reason, I guess everyone's over at Isbell Marant. They're donating everything, or maybe there was some storage of it that got into our flow of items, and now all the bins are getting it. Best, yeah, I mean, if you guys want Isbell Marant, you good easily go to the bins and get it. We especially get, like, fringe boots and, like, the white tops, things like that. We get a lot of those.
